Job Purpose:
This role is responsible for providing overall strategic leadership and direction to the Manufacturing function to ensure efficient and effective operations and the availability of products and services anchored on the short, medium and long-term plan of the company.

Duties and Responsibilities:

1. Manufacturing Operations

  • Provides strategic direction and guidance in creating an effective and robust manufacturing strategy to support the business requirements
  • Ensures that manufacturing systems and processes are in place to produce products at the right time and cost.
  • Provides strategic leadership in manufacturing and footprint planning including strategies for operational synergy and expansion.
  • Puts in place the definition and tracking of manufacturing KPIs and dashboards ensuring that these are reflective of the overall business strategy

2. Projects and CAPEX Management

  • Leads in developing CAPEX strategies, identifying and prioritizing projects that supports the overall business strategy
  • Oversees the timely implementation and tracking of CAPEX projects, time, cost, and overall result

3. Performance Management & Improvement

  • Establishes, drives, monitors, and benchmarks Key Performance Indicators to ensure that logistics performance is properly and proactively managed
  • Leads in the identification and implementation of improvement initiatives to reduce distribution cost and other related costs, increase operational efficiency and capability, optimize the use of company resources

4. Annual Operating Plan and Cost Management

  • Prepares department budget, monitors and ensures operational expenses are within approved budget
  • Evaluates and implements cost-savings opportunities while maintaining the quality and level of service
  • Leads Logistics team in identifying and implementing continuous improvement initiatives to reduce waste, improve quality, increase productivity, and maximize resources

5. Organization and People Development

  • Coaches, mentors, and identifies training and developmental needs and job competencies of line personnel to build a well-informed, well-trained, empowered workforce, and stable organization
  • Conducts periodic staff meeting to update plans and initiatives
  • Engages the workforce in establishing harmonious relationships and follows the proper implementation of Company Rules & Regulations including discipline, work attendance, etc

 

Direct Reports:

Head, Area Operation

Head, Quality Assurance & Standards

Head, Manufacturing Excellence
